Regulations depend on the MFFP fishing zone covering Rivière Chaudière and may include water-body specific exceptions. Each spot fact-sheet shows the applicable zone and links to the official rules at peche.faune.gouv.qc.ca/regpec.
Yes. A standard MFFP fishing license is required in Quebec (~$24/year for residents). Buy online at sepaq.com. Some access points at Rivière Chaudière may also require a SEPAQ wildlife reserve or municipal access pass — check the spot fact-sheet.
